How Dehumidification Services Actually Work

Our team follows a proven process to ensure your home is dry and safe. First, we assess the damage and identify the source of the moisture. Next, we use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the area. Finally, we monitor the moisture levels to ensure everything is back to normal.

Assessment and Planning

Our technicians arrive at your property and assess the damage. We use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and identify the source of the issue. This helps us create a customized plan to get your home back to normal.

Water Extraction

We use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your home. This is a critical step to prevent further damage and ensure your home is safe to inhabit.

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, we use specialized equipment to dry the area. This includes indust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ers that work together to remove moisture from the air.

Moisture Monitoring

Our technicians monitor the moisture levels in your home to ensure everything is back to normal. This is a critical step to prevent further damage and ensure your home remains safe.

Dehumidification Services Cost in Federal Way, WA

The cost of Dehumidification Services in Federal Way, WA var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Dehumidification Services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the size of the affected area
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age
Moisture Monitoring $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the number of monitoring sessions
Dehumidification Equipment Rental $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the rental duration
Dehumidification Services for a Small Home $1,500 – $6,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age
Dehumidification Services for a Large Home $3,000 – $12,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
